Can you get a fishing license in Illinois if you owe back child support?

Since September, the Illinois Department of Healthcare and Family Services has been hooked into the computerized license renewal system for the Illinois Department of Natural Resources and people who are behind on child support payments are not allowed to renew hunting and fishing licenses

How can I check to see if my license is suspended in Illinois?

Call the Secretary of State at 217-782-6212 and press option 1 to check if your license is valid Have your Social Security Number and Driver’s License Number handy Your license might still have a suspension or a hold if there were multiple reasons for suspension/hold on your record

How far behind in child support before license suspended Ohio?

Before the CSEA can notify the BMV to suspend a license, the person paying support must have failed to pay at least 50 percent of their total monthly support obligation for a period of 90 consecutive days

How do I get my license back after suspension in Ohio?

Driving privileges are suspended for a period of six months and requires a $40 reinstatement fee Mail reinstatement fees to: Ohio Bureau of Motor Vehicles, Attn: PO BOX 16520, Columbus, OH 43216-6520 You may request an administrative hearing by writing to the BMV within 30 days of the date of the suspension notice

How much back child support is a felony in Ohio?

Ohio law provides criminal penalties for parents who fail to pay support for more than 26 out of 104 weeks, or who owe “arrearages” (overdue child support payments) in excess of $5,000 Special prosecutors handle these matters, and extensive non-payment of support is considered a felony

How much back child support is a felony in Missouri?

Criminal prosecution possible if paying parent fails to pay child support for six months within a twelve-month period or an aggregate delinquency of more than five thousand dollars is a felony
